    From the owner: At Gen H Wellness Acupuncture & Holistic Medicine , we specialize in a wide range of health…read moreconcerns, with a focus on providing holistic and effective treatments for pain management, orthopedic issues, and women’s health. Whether you’re dealing with chronic pain, menstrual issues, pregnancy-related discomfort, labor , postpartum recovery, or menopause symptoms, we are here to support your wellness journey. Our expertise also extends to conditions like endometriosis, fibroids, and complex chronic health conditions, such as Lyme disease and chronic fatigue syndrome. Using personalized acupuncture treatments, we aim to address both the root cause and symptoms of these conditions, helping you achieve long-term relief and improved quality of life. Whether you’re looking to ease pain, balance hormones, or manage a chronic condition, our compassionate and experienced practitioners are dedicated to guiding you toward healing and restoration.
